What Is an AI Agent?
An AI agent is software designed to perform tasks with some degree of autonomy.
Instead of answering a single question and stopping, an agent can potentially work toward a goal, use digital tools, communicate with other services and make decisions within limits set by its user or developer.
Imagine an AI system responsible for managing a digital service.
It might need to purchase computing resources, pay for data, access an API or compensate another automated service.
Suddenly, the AI doesn't only need intelligence.
It needs economic infrastructure.
AI Has a Money Problem
The internet was primarily designed around humans and organizations.
Traditional financial accounts normally require identity verification, legal agreements and banking relationships.
Software can't simply walk into a bank and open an account for itself.
Crypto introduces a different model.
A blockchain wallet can interact with digital assets through software.
That makes blockchain-based payments potentially interesting for autonomous systems.
An AI agent doesn't necessarily need a traditional bank card if it can operate through a properly controlled digital wallet.
Machines Don't Need to Become Investors
This is the key distinction.
Humans often use crypto because they expect an asset to increase in value.
AI agents wouldn't necessarily care.
An agent might receive a stablecoin and spend that stablecoin minutes later.
It isn't investing.
It's transacting.
That means AI adoption of crypto could look completely different from previous waves of adoption.
The important metric might not be how many machines are “holding” tokens.
It could be how much economic activity machines conduct through blockchain rails.
Stablecoins Could Be a Natural Fit
Price stability matters when paying for services.
Imagine an AI agent needs to purchase $20 worth of computing power.
Using an asset that could move sharply in price creates unnecessary complexity.
A dollar-linked stablecoin provides a much simpler unit of account.
The agent can understand that $20 is approximately $20 without constantly managing large price fluctuations.
This is why the AI-and-crypto story may ultimately be more about stablecoins and payments than speculative AI tokens.

Micropayments Could Matter
Traditional payment infrastructure isn't always designed for extremely small, frequent machine-to-machine payments.
Transaction fees, settlement delays and account requirements can make tiny payments inefficient.
Blockchain-based systems could potentially provide alternative ways to handle some of these transactions.
An AI agent might pay a tiny amount for one API request, a piece of data, computing time or another digital resource.
Instead of buying a monthly subscription, software could potentially pay only for what it uses.
That could create entirely new business models.

Smart Contracts Add Another Layer
Payments aren't the only possible use.
AI agents could interact with smart contracts.
An agent might follow predefined rules for spending, exchanging assets or accessing services.
Smart contracts could also impose restrictions.
For example, an agent might be authorized to spend only a certain amount or interact only with approved applications.
That could create a system where automation exists without giving software unlimited financial control.
The safeguards would be just as important as the automation itself.
Security Could Become the Biggest Challenge
Giving software access to money creates obvious risks.
An incorrectly configured agent could make unwanted transactions.
A compromised agent could expose funds.
Malicious instructions could potentially manipulate automated systems.
Smart-contract vulnerabilities could add another layer of risk.
Crypto transactions can also be difficult or impossible to reverse.
So an AI-powered machine economy would require strong security, permissions, spending limits and human oversight.
Autonomy without controls would be dangerous.
